Captain America: The First Avenger hit theaters in 2011 and instantly became a cultural landmark in superhero cinema. Directed by Joe Johnston and starring Chris Evans in the titular role, this film not only launched a billion-dollar cinematic universe but also redefined the modern superhero archetype. At its core is Steve Rogers—a slight, principled patriot transformed into the moral compass of the Avengers. But beyond the silver shield and shield-wielding action, Captain America: The First Avenger explores themes of sacrifice, leadership, and identity that resonate deeply with audiences.

Critical Reception and Legacy
Captain America: The First Avenger received widespread acclaim for its respectful storytelling, strong performances (especially Chris Evans), and refreshing take on the character. Though initially viewed as a franchise starter, it’s now recognized not only as a commercial hit but as a thoughtful gateway to the Marvel Cinematic Universe (MCU). The film’s emphasis on character development laid the foundation for subsequent Avengers films, culminating in cinematic masterpieces like Avengers: Endgame.
